The CW
The CW is quite the popular kid these days. As of the 2014-2015 season, it is home to two of the hottest superhero series on TV, a genre stalwart that keeps building its audience even after 10 seasons, and a telenovela-flavored dramedy that snagged the network its first Golden Globe and a Peabody. Almost everything on The CW's schedule is working, so there aren't many contenders sitting on the fence between renewal and oblivion.
Already Renewed: Pretty much everything. But to be specific: "iZombie,"The 100," "Arrow," "America's Next Top Model," "The Flash," "Beauty and the Beast," "Jane the Virgin," "Masters of Illusion," "The Originals," "Reign," "Supernatural," "The Vampire Diaries," and "Whose Line Is It Anyway?"
